    Hi

    I have Winfax Pro 10.02 installed , my operating system is Windows XP home SP2 and I have MS Office 2002 installed. I do have Outlook installed, but my default email is OE. The fax program faxes fine, however my personal information has recently changed and I cannot update the user information or other set up information in the program. As soon as I try to update any user information the Winfax Pro Message Manager program closes or I get a fault protection message.

    Any suggestions?

    Just a note.. (the fix worked!) on Re-Start I got a BSD and had to use Last Known Good. Problem apparently was Ahead Nero 6 when Text Services = OFF. When I turned Text Service = ON the system Re-Start was successful. Also, first attempt to enter the wtnsetup CSID failed. I did another re-start and next time left the CSID field blank and just clicked NEXT to complete the setup. It works! Big Thanks to MARIE and getfaxing forums.
